[0033] Example I: Effect of Solvent

example I-1

[0035] Dissolve 11.2g (0.2mol) of potassium hydroxide in 50g (0.5mol) of trifluoroethanol, add 100 grams of DMF solvent, seal in a 500mL autoclave, cool at low temperature, and introduce 130 grams (1.58mol) of trifluoroethylene in vacuum , heated to 78°C, and reacted for 6.5 hours. 89.2 grams of crude product were obtained by distillation, with a yield of 94.8%.

example I-2

[0037] Dissolve 11.2g (0.2mol) of potassium hydroxide in 50g (0.5mol) of trifluoroethanol, add 100 grams of DMSO solvent, seal in a 500mL autoclave, cool at low temperature, and introduce 130 grams (1.58mol) of trifluoroethylene in vacuum , heated to 78°C, and reacted for 6.5 hours. 87.3 grams of crude product were obtained by distillation, with a yield of 92.8%.

[0038] In the comparison of example I-1 and I-2, the yield is slightly higher than that of DMSO with DMF as the solvent. At the same time, during the distillation and purification process, DMSO has a partial decomposition phenomenon, which increases the loss of solvent and affects the purity of the product.

[0039] Because trifluoroethylene is a geometrically asymmetric structure, two isomers are formed when it is added to alcohol:

Abstract

A process for preparing hydrofluoroether features the reaction between one of trifluoroethene, tetrafluoroethene, hexafluoro propene, etc and one of trifluoroethanol, trifluoropropanol, metanol, etc in organic solvent (DMF or DMSO). Its advantages are high output rate and easy purifying and separating.

technical field [0001] The invention relates to a class of ether compounds containing fluorine, carbon, hydrogen and oxygen elements, in particular to a novel hydrofluoroether in a high-boiling organic solvent and a preparation method thereof. Background technique [0002] Hydrofluoroether (HFE, abbreviation for Hydrofluoroether) is a class of ether compounds containing fluorine, carbon, hydrogen, and oxygen elements. It is a new generation of substitutes for ozone depleting substances (ODS, abbreviation for Ozone Depleting Substance), and it does not destroy the ozone layer. , the greenhouse effect is small. New compounds that can be used in cleaning, refrigeration, foaming, medicine and other fields.
